Free KidsDay event on Saturday, June 9 at Columbia SportsPark

Mini-golf, batting cages and much more!

KidsDay — the fun, annual welcome-to-summer event for kids hosted by Columbia Association (CA) — returns on Saturday, June 9 from 10am to 2pm at Columbia SportsPark, 5453 Harpers Farm Road, toward the back of Harper’s Choice Village Center.

KidsDay is free and open to the public. Preregistration is appreciated but not required; please preregister at ColumbiaAssociation.org/kidsday.

Mini-golf and all-you-can-bat batting cage sessions will be free for all kids ages 12 and younger as well as all CA Fit&Play, Play, 5Day Golf&Play, and Golf Fit&Play members of any age. Non-members and other CA members ages 13 and older will pay a fee.

There will also be numerous other free and fun options available to all, including games, inflatables, face painting, demos, giveaways and more. Food and beverages will be available for purchase.

While you and your family are having fun, learn more about CA’s youth programs, classes, camps and special offers. KidsDay is the start of a great summer for your kids, and there are so many ways for the fun to continue.

About Columbia Association
Columbia Association (CA) is a nonprofit community services corporation that manages Columbia, Maryland, a planned community that is home to approximately 100,000 people and several thousand businesses — and was named the No. 1 small city to live in by Money Magazine in 2016.
